Overview Ckent-A Tablet
A-Ckent tablets combine medications to treat coughs. This formulation alleviates allergic symptoms including sneezing, nasal discharge, eye watering, itching, swelling, and nasal or sinus congestion. It also helps thin and liquefy mucus, facilitating expectoration. A-Ckent tablets are administered with or without food, following the physician's prescribed dosage and duration. Dosage is individualized based on your health status and response. Continue treatment as directed by your doctor; premature discontinuation may lead to symptom recurrence and condition exacerbation. Inform your doctor about all other medications you're using, as interactions are possible. Common side effects include indigestion, dry mouth, headache, tiredness, and allergic reactions; most are transient and self-limiting. Report any concerning side effects immediately. Dizziness and drowsiness are potential side effects; avoid driving or tasks requiring alertness until the effects are known. Alcohol consumption should be avoided due to increased dizziness risk. Self-medication and recommending this medicine to others are strictly prohibited. Adequate hydration is recommended during treatment. Disclose any kidney or liver conditions, and p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should consult their doctor before use.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Concurrent use of Ckent-A Tablets and alcohol may result in significant sleepiness.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Ckent-A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against any possible ris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ice before use.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data on Ckent-A Tablet use while breastfeeding is lacking. Seek medical advice from your physician.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king Ckent-A Tablets might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, or induce drowsiness and dizziness. Refrain from driving if you experience these effects.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Ckent-A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dose modification under medical supervision. The use of Ckent-A Tablets is contraindicated in individuals with severe kidney disease.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should exercise caution when using Ckent-A Tablets. Dosage modification for Ckent-A Tablets may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Ckent-A Tablet :
Should you forget to take a Ckent-A Tablet, administer it at your earliest convenience. If, however, your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ual medication timetable. Never take a double dose.
